Lady of the Roses

Author: Sandra Worth
During her short time as a ward in Queen Marguerite’s Lancastrian court, fifteen-year-old Isobel has had many suitors ask for her hand, but the spirited beauty is blind to all but Yorkist Sir John Neville.
